Attachment A <br />Roseville 2020 Legislative Priorities <br />Allow Municipal Hotel Licensing <br />Over the past several years, both City Council and staff have expressed interest in the ability to <br />establish a hotel/motel licensing program similar to theCity’scurrent multi-family licensing <br />program. Business organizations have asked the City’s help in improving the quality and safety <br />of Roseville hotels and motels. In response staff has begun investigating available options for a <br />potential municipal hotel/motel licensing program. <br />Following extensive investigation and conversations at the local, county, and state levels it was <br />determined that best course of action would be toestablish new legislation allowing for <br />municipal licensing. <br />In March 2017, the Fire Roseville Department received City Council approval to take over local <br />inspections of all hotels and motels from the State Fire Marshal’s office. <br />In the 2019 Legislative Session, at Roseville’s request, bills were introduced (HF 1765/SF <br />2181) that allows municipalities to directly license hotels and motels <br />The City of Roseville supports the passage any legislation that allows for municipal hotel <br />licensing. <br /> Approved January 27, 2020 <br /> <br /> <br />
